Army Intelligence Frees Two Kidnapped Syrians in Wadi Khaled

Beirut: The Army Command - Directorate of Orientation has announced the successful rescue of two Syrian nationals who were kidnapped in Beirut. The Intelligence Directorate conducted a series of security operations, leading to the liberation of the individuals, identified as (H.S.) and (B.S.), in Majdal - Wadi Khaled on February 23, 2026.

According to National News Agency - Lebanon, the victims were initially lured to the Cola area in Beirut on February 19, 2026. They were then abducted by a gang that subsequently demanded a ransom for their release. The Army Command has confirmed that investigations are ongoing to apprehend those responsible for the kidnapping.
